MS SQL Eğitimlerimize MAX fonksiyonu ile devam ediyoruz.

MAX fonksiyonu arama yaptığımız kolondaki en büyük değeri döner geriye. 

Şöyle bir senaryo düşünebilirsiniz. Bir firmada bir performans değerlendirme tablonuz var. Herkesin aldığı bir puan var. 1000 lerce çalışanınız var ve en yüksek puanı alan kişinin maaşına %5 zam gerçekleştiriliyor olsun. (Yöneticiler böyle güzel şeyler yapın çalışanlarınıza)

Böyle bir durumda 1000 kişiyi tek tek incelemek çok zorlu ve meşakkatli bir iş. İşte bunun yerine tabloda değerin tutulduğu kolon üzerinde MAX fonksiyonunu çalıştırırsak istediğimiz veriyi bize geri dönecektir.

Kullanımı

SELECT MAX(KOLON_ADI) FROM TABLO_ADI

Canlı bir örnek ile görelim.

XENONBOX  veritabanımızda bulunan ORDERS tablomuzda en yüksek fiyatlı siparişin kaç para olduğunu öğrenelim.

SELECT MAX(TOTALAMOUNT) FROM ORDERS

SELECT MAX(TOTALAMOUNT) AS [EN YÜKSEK FİYAT] FROM ORDERS

Bu yazımızda bu kadardı bir sonraki yazımda görüşmek üzere.


What's Your Reaction?

hate hate
0
hate
fail fail
0
fail
fun fun
0
fun
geeky geeky
0
geeky
love love
0
love
lol lol
0
lol
omg omg
0
omg
win win
0
win
Murat Bilginer
21 Şubat 1992 Doğumlu. Endüstri Mühendisi olarak Lisansını 2016 yılında tamamlamıştır. Industryolog Akademi - NGenius oluşumlarının kurucusudur. Şu anda kendi şirketi Brainy Tech ile hem Yazılım Hizmetleri Sunmakta Hem de Online Eğitimler Vermektedir.